A bond, the one between JLR and Sardinia, that is renewed every year and grows stronger. Range Rover, for the third year running the official “tender” of the Yacht Club Costa Smeralda and courtesy car of the Ferretti group, is now at home in Porto Cervo. Right here, where the Maxi Yacht Rolex Cup regattas will soon start, Range Rover is present with its own Conciergerie at the Waterfront, the luxury village created by architect Giò Pagani in the spaces of Porto Vecchio.

New design for Defender and Land Rover

Clean lines, materials and design choices that have an impact on improving the car’s sustainability are a reflection of the codes of Modern Luxury, a modernist and Bauhaus style that Gerry McGovern OBE, JLR’s Chief Creative Officer, wanted to imprint on the Range Rover and Defender lines.
